Breaking News: The annual Peach Music Festival will not be returning to its regular venue at Montage Mountain in 2024.

Now, some may assume that I’m happy about the lost revenue, but that’s not the case. I’m relieved that there won’t be any festival-related tragedies in our hometown this year. Unfortunately, such incidents occur annually. Check out the information below and also via this link to find out where they’re headed, and if that’s your scene, enjoy! […]